New Granite Pavers Cracking by SpecificPressure2 in landscaping

[–]wizardofcat42 4 points5 points  (0 children)

Yeah my guess is it shouldn't be installed over mortar like that. likely the slab and mortar are shifting with temperature changes and the granite being mortared and grouted in place can't move and is getting cracked.
